Output 56fd70dcfe267fb00f842715b8d7fd35c68260403d8940fb780596f11845268c:24

value
1551461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0698ec45e7a01fec8b9ec1843094633ed92d76ed OP_EQUAL
address
32HuAy3EHsFuqZBPWeM6a2nVbx8w1pxMXS
transaction
56fd70dcfe267fb00f842715b8d7fd35c68260403d8940fb780596f11845268c
spent
true